AI Regulation and Governance Discussed Ahead of 2024 Election
The upcoming U.S. presidential election is poised to significantly impact the regulation of artificial intelligence (AI) in healthcare, with Vice President Kamala Harris advocating for more oversight while former President Donald Trump favors deregulation. Trump's potential election could stall or dismantle current initiatives aimed at ensuring safe AI practices in the health sector, as the Biden administration prepares to announce a regulatory plan by January. Meanwhile, industry leaders emphasize the need for standardized frameworks to govern AI use for patient safety and outcomes. The conversation around AI also extends to its role in political engagement, with concerns about misinformation and the ethical implications for businesses as AI transforms voter interaction. Events like the IIT Bay Area Leadership Conference highlight the dual-edged nature of AI's rise, focusing on its potential benefits and the necessary shifts in governance and data management. Overall, the intersection of AI and politics is critical for entrepreneurs to navigate as regulatory landscapes evolve.
